Why These Are the Top Kitchen Remodeling Contractors in Rimersburg

** The kitchen remodeling market in the Rimersburg area is characterized by a small number of highly established local contractors and several reputable options within a 20-mile radius. Due to the rural nature of Clarion County, the competition is not saturated, but the quality among the top-tier providers is consistently high. Homeowners value reputation, longevity, and word-of-mouth referrals highly. Typical pricing is moderate and competitive for a rural Pennsylvania market. A full kitchen remodel can range from $15,000 for a basic update with stock cabinets and laminate countertops to $50,000+ for a high-end project with custom cabinetry, quartz or granite countertops, and professional-grade appliances. The most successful contractors in this region are those who offer a personalized approach and can demonstrate a portfolio of completed projects for local residents. It is always recommended to get at least three detailed quotes and verify current licensing and insurance before proceeding with any project.

1What is a realistic budget range for a full kitchen remodel in Rimersburg, PA?

For a full remodel in Rimersburg, including new cabinets, countertops, flooring, and appliances, homeowners should budget between $25,000 and $50,000, with high-end projects exceeding that. Local material and labor costs are generally more affordable than in major Pennsylvania metros, but fluctuating supply chain logistics can impact pricing. It's wise to get 3-4 detailed estimates from Clarion County contractors to establish a clear local benchmark for your specific project scope.

2How does the seasonal climate in Rimersburg affect the remodeling timeline?

Rimersburg's cold, snowy winters can delay projects that require material deliveries or involve exterior work, like window replacement or dumpster placement. The ideal time to start a remodel is late spring through early fall to avoid weather delays. However, indoor work can proceed year-round; scheduling with a local contractor well in advance is key, as their schedules can fill up quickly during the more favorable seasons.

3Are there any local permits or regulations in Rimersburg I need to know about for my kitchen remodel?

Yes, most structural, electrical, and plumbing work in Rimersburg Borough requires permits from the local municipal office. Pennsylvania's Uniform Construction Code (UCC) applies, and your contractor should handle this process. A specific local consideration is ensuring your project complies with any historical or zoning regulations if your home is in a designated area, so checking with the borough office is an essential first step.

5My Rimersburg home has well water and a septic system. Does this impact a kitchen remodel?

Absolutely. Any plumbing changes must be carefully planned to avoid disrupting the pressure tank or overburdening your septic system. Installing a garbage disposal is generally not recommended with a septic system, and your contractor should advise on septic-safe fixtures. A local professional will understand these common rural Pennsylvania systems and can ensure new plumbing integrates properly without causing costly backups or damage.
